Background
The screen printer is called a screen printer, and is a device for printing soldering paste or surface mount adhesive on a PCB pad through a screen; can be divided into a vertical screen printer, a slant arm screen printer, a rotary screen printer, a four-column screen printer and a full-automatic screen printer; the main application is in the electronics processing trade, and the silk screen printing of printed circuit board is marked, the sign of instrument housing panel, and the solder paste printing etc. in the circuit board course of working also develops constantly in the aspect of the silk screen printing machine along with the development of science and technology, and continuous progress, wherein silk screen printing machine fixture is also in wide use.
At present, current silk screen printing machine fixture, the exterior structure is more fixed, inconvenient dismantlement to the device, and has certain requirement to required processing article volume, and when the processing article volume is too little, then be difficult to accomplish all-round fixed, it is insecure to required processing article, leads to the device to appear the damage of processing article when processing easily.

Detailed Description
The present invention will be further described with reference to the accompanying drawings and embodiments.
Please refer to fig. 1, fig. 2, fig. 3 and fig. 4, wherein fig. 1 is a schematic front internal structure diagram of a novel accurately-positioned screen printing machine fixture provided by the present invention; FIG. 2 is a schematic view of a pulley structure of a novel accurately-positioned fixture of a screen printing machine provided by the present invention; FIG. 3 is a schematic diagram of a structure of a screen printing head of a novel accurately-positioned screen printing machine fixture provided by the present invention; fig. 4 is the utility model provides a pair of novel fixed platform schematic structure of accurate silk screen printing machine fixture of location. A novel screen printer fixture with accurate positioning comprises a case 1, a fixed platform 8, a rotary connecting block 11 and an electric heater 21, wherein a base 2 is arranged below the case 1, a maintenance cover 3 is arranged on the outer side of the rear side of the case 1, a first rotary rod 4 is arranged on the right side of the maintenance cover 3, pulley shields 5 are arranged below the base 2, brake blocks 6 are arranged below the pulley shields 5, pulleys 7 are arranged below the brake blocks 6, the fixed platform 8 is arranged above the case 1, movable handles 9 are arranged on the left side and the right side of the fixed platform 8, fixing clamps 10 are arranged on the inner sides of the movable handles 9, the rotary connecting blocks 11 are arranged on the left side and the right side of the fixed platform 8, handrails 12 are arranged on the outer side of the rotary connecting blocks 11, a lifting back plate 13 is arranged above the fixed platform 8, and a movable transverse plate 14 is arranged behind the lifting back plate 13, remove the outside of horizontal version 14 and install silk screen printing aircraft nose 15, and the inside two walls of silk screen printing aircraft nose 15 all are provided with track 16, and track 16's inside pulley all is connected with printing ink and changes box 17 simultaneously, and the below of silk screen printing aircraft nose 15 is provided with silk screen printing board 18, and silk screen printing board 18's below installs protective cover 19, and protective cover 19's the right-hand second rotary rod 20 that is provided with of while, and electric heater 21 installs in the inside of silk screen printing board 18.
The left end of maintenance lid 3 constitutes swivelling joint through the outer wall of first rotary rod 4 and quick-witted case 1's outer wall, and maintains for screw connection between lid 3 and the quick-witted case 1, through the maintenance lid 3 that sets up, can cover 3 maintenance through first rotary rod 4 rotatory to suitable position, can conveniently reduce the maintenance cost to the device's maintenance and clearance like this, reduces the cost of labor.
The upper end that the lower extreme of brake block 6 passes through pulley guard shield 5 constitutes extending structure with the outer wall of pulley 7, and is connected for the draw-in groove between brake block 6 and the pulley 7, through the brake block 6 that sets up, can sink into brake block 6 to suitable position through pulley guard shield 5, can sink into to stop the device like this, makes it steadily fixed, avoids the device to produce when the operation to rock, influences the user and operates.
The outer wall of fixation clamp 10 constitutes sliding structure through the inner wall that removes handle 9 and fixation platform 8's inner wall, and removes handle 9 and set up about fixation platform 8's axis symmetry, through the fixation clamp 10 that sets up, can slide fixation clamp 10 to fixation clamp 10 and required fixed object laminating state through removing handle 9, can fix required processing article like this, avoid processing man-hour because of not fixing good processing article, lead to processing failure, improve work efficiency, reduce the processing spoilage.
The outer wall that the inner wall of handrail 12 passes through swivel connected block 11 constitutes swivelling joint with fixed platform 8's outer wall, and swivel connected block 11 sets up about fixed platform 8's axis symmetry, through the handrail 12 that sets up, can pass through swivel connected block 11 with handrail 12 and rotate to suitable position, can conveniently remove and carry the device like this, has solved the device because the volume is too big, does not have the inconvenience that the stress point brought, reduces the cost of labor.
The inner wall of printing ink replacement box 17 passes through the inner wall of track 16 and constitutes sliding construction with the inner wall of silk screen printing aircraft nose 15, and track 16 is around the axis symmetry setting of printing ink replacement box 17, through the printing ink replacement box 17 that sets up, can slide printing ink replacement box 17 to suitable position through track 16, and the printing ink of using to the inside required processing of the device that like this can be convenient is changed and is cleared up, improves work efficiency, reduces the maintenance cost.
The left end of protective cover 19 constitutes swivelling joint through the outer wall of second rotary rod 20 and the outer wall of silk screen printing board 18, and is the screw connection between protective cover 19 and the silk screen printing board 18, through the protective cover 19 that sets up, can rotate protective cover 19 to suitable position through second rotary rod 20, can avoid the device like this at the inside deposition of idle time silk screen printing board 18, leads to the damage of the device, increases the device's life.
The utility model provides a pair of novel silk screen printing machine fixture's of accurate location theory of operation as follows:
firstly, the device is moved to a required working position, then the brake block 6 is extended downwards through the pulley shield 5 to a state that the brake block 6 is clamped with the pulley 7, so that the brake block is sunk and stopped, then the movable transverse plate 14 is lifted downwards to a proper position through the lifting back plate 13, then the screen printing head 15 is moved leftwards to a proper position through the movable transverse plate 14, then the ink replacing box 17 is slid backwards to a proper position through the rail 16, then the ink is replaced, then the protective cover 19 is rotated downwards to a proper position through the second rotating rod 20, then a required processing object is placed into the fixed platform 8, then the fixed clamp 10 is slid to a state that the fixed clamp 10 is attached to the required fixed object through the movable handle 9 to be stably fixed, then the maintenance cover 3 is rotated downwards to a proper position through the first rotating rod 4 to check the internal state of the device, and finally the electric heater 21 is connected with a power supply, open the switch, because electric heater 21 is connected with silk screen printing board 18, silk screen printing board 18 heats through electric heater 21, with the laminating heating of silk screen printing board 18 and required processing article, process required processing article, accomplished the use of the silk screen printing machine fixture of just such a novel accurate location, electric heater 21 model is GYXY1-380 in this case, accomplishes the use of this novel accurate location's silk screen printing machine fixture like this, the utility model relates to an electrical property technique is prior art.
